Salary: Up to £13.00 per hour (depending on level of experience, training and qualification) Sarum Road Hospital in Winchester is part of Circle Health Group, Britain's leading provider of independent healthcare with a nationwide network of hospitals & clinics, performing more complex surgery than any other private healthcare provider in the country.

We have an opportunity for a Senior Healthcare Assistant to join their team of staff in the nursing department.

Chestnut Ward at Sarum Road Hospital is a welcoming surgical unit providing a range of elective inpatient and day-case services, including orthopaedics, urology, gynaecology, ophthalmology, general surgery, maxillofacial, and other procedures.

We are seeking fully flexible Senior HCA Bank Staff to join our wider team and support us in maintaining the highest standards of patient care.

Working on an as and when required basis, you will be required to supplement staffing levels during busy periods and provide cover for existing staff in times of annual leave or absence.

This is an excellent opportunity to gain experience within the independent healthcare sector and explore career pathways you may not have previously considered.

Duties

  • Deliver person-centred care including assisting with personal hygiene, nutrition, mobility, toileting, and emotional support.
  • Carry out basic clinical tasks such as monitoring vital signs, blood glucose levels, and patient observations (following training and competency).
  • Assist with clinical procedures and the preparation of equipment and materials.
  • Report any changes in a patient’s condition to the nursing team promptly.
  • Act as a role model and mentor to junior healthcare assistants, supporting their development and integration into the team.
  • Help coordinate the daily allocation of tasks, ensuring care is prioritised appropriately.

Requirements

  • NVQ Level 2 or 3 in Health and Social Care (or equivalent qualification/experience).
  • Experience working as a Healthcare Assistant in a hospital or clinical setting.
  • Ability to carry out delegated clinical tasks safely and confidently.
  • Strong communication and interpersonal skills.
  • Ability to support and supervise junior staff members.
